Brill Power, in collaboration with Lithium Valley, has launched the HELIOS battery module at SNEC, China’s largest battery and energy storage exhibition. Designed for industrial and utility-scale battery systems, HELIOS enhances performance and increases battery utilisation by up to 61%.
At its core is BrillCore, Brill Power’s patented battery management technology, which actively loads battery modules to overcome limitations caused by weaker cells. This approach maximises energy use while continuously balancing packs during charge and discharge, improving efficiency and reducing downtime.
HELIOS also boosts system availability by isolating failed modules, allowing the BESS rack to remain operational. Integrated power conversion at the rack level helps maintain DC voltage, while independent charge/discharge cycles eliminate the need for full system resets every four to six weeks.
Brill Power’s BrillOS firmware has been refined for HELIOS, enabling over-the-air updates and optimising state-of-charge (SoC) and state-of-health (SoH) algorithms throughout the system’s lifespan. This improves trading decisions for asset owners and enhances confidence in SoX reporting for BESS OEMs.
The HELIOS module integrates Brill Power’s technology with high-grade 314Ah LFP cells, reducing the levelised-cost-of-storage for BESS by up to 26%.
